Market Position and Competitive Landscape

OurBus positions itself as a flexible alternative to both legacy carriers and regional operators by emphasizing direct routes and digital booking. In markets where ourbus operates, price-sensitive leisure and business travelers compare our fares against Amtrak, Megabus, and local charter services. The company’s willingness to adjust schedules based on demand helps it capture market share without aggressively undercutting margins.

Operational Efficiency and Asset Utilization

Higher utilization of each bus drives stronger ourbus net worth, because more tickets per vehicle increase revenue without proportional cost growth. Maintenance contracts, driver training, and real-time dispatching tools keep downtime low and on-time performance high. By balancing load factors across off-peak and peak services, the network smooths cash flow and supports long-term financing options.
